For the 2026 school year, there is 1 private school serving 4 students in Sebastian, FL (there are , serving 4,350 public students). Less than 1% of all K-12 students in Sebastian, FL are educated in private schools (compared to the FL state average of 14%).
100% of private schools in Sebastian, FL are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ian).
